Indonesia Energy Corporation (INDO) trades at $2.89, down 1.03% on the day, with a bullish technical signal from moving averages but neutral oscillators. The company is actively drilling the K-29 well at its Kruh Block, indicating operational progress. Financially, it shows deep losses with a net income margin of -253.4% and negative ROE of -26.95% for 2025, though it beat EPS estimates in Q2 2025. Valuation metrics include a P/S of 21.57 and P/B of 2.32, reflecting high sales multiples amid profitability challenges.
The outlook hinges on successful well outcomes driving future revenue; current analyst consensus is 100% buy, but high execution risks and persistent losses pose significant threats to shareholder value. Investors face volatility from oil price swings and operational delays.
RLX trades at $2.01, up 0.5% on the day, with a bearish technical signal from moving averages but neutral oscillators. The company reported Q1 2026 revenue growth driven by international expansion, with a net income margin of 22.47% in 2026. Recent news highlights its Q2 2026 earnings call scheduled for August 14, 2026, focusing on European integration.
The outlook is mixed: strong international revenue growth and solid profitability support upside, but consecutive earnings misses and a single analyst's hold rating indicate caution. Key risks include regulatory scrutiny in the vaping industry and execution challenges in global markets.

Indonesia Energy is an oil and gas exploration and production company. It focuses on identifying and developing energy resources in Indonesia, primarily through its Kruh and Citarum blocks.
